Storyline
Plot Summary |
The writer Pierre Carot became rich and famous with his book "Life as a Couple", which was based on the loving relationships of four couples. Now he's setting up his will and wants to leave his wealth to the couples among the four, which are still as deeply in love - if any: else, his companions get the money. He sends them out to visit the couples and test their love.

Trivia | Sacha Guitry's original screenplay contains digests of a few of his plays, "Désiré", "L'illusionniste", "Une paire de gifles", "Le blanc et le noir" and "Françoise". See more » |
